Transaction 43a83d3b751e199af771680cfdf73d86d40e1eb4c3a5becd895398454181c840

2 Input
2 Outputs
  • 43a83d3b751e199af771680cfdf73d86d40e1eb4c3a5becd895398454181c840:0
  • value  3045114
    address  32XtYLson692BDDJ9qAyDnqksm4Vuhs8W2
  • 43a83d3b751e199af771680cfdf73d86d40e1eb4c3a5becd895398454181c840:1
  • value  39803
    address  17giJGKicgvaQYiXqpw4j49shhZinPCWiP